Comprehensive parameters ensuring precise matching with your equipment requirements.
| Product Series | Thickness (μm) | Temp Max (°C) | Flame Spread | Tear Resist | Compliance |
|---|---|---|---|---|---|
| Ultra-Guard 900 | 120 μm | 850°C | Class A | High | UL 94 V-0 / EN 13501 |
| Thermal-Pro 700 | 100 μm | 700°C | Class A | Medium | ASTM E84 |
| Eco-Shield 500 | 80 μm | 500°C | Class B | Medium | ISO 9001 |
| Aero-Guard LX | 60 μm | 900°C | Class A | Low | AS9100 / UL |
| Industrial-X | 150 μm | 600°C | Class B | Extreme | Industrial Standard |
| Pure-Flow FR | 40 μm | 400°C | Class C | Low | FDA Compliant |
| Titan-Wrap FR | 200 μm | 1000°C | Class A+ | Maximum | Military Grade |
| Custom-Fit FR | Variable | Variable | Custom | Custom | Tailored Specification |
Note: All specifications are based on standardized ASTM testing. Custom thickness and heat ratings are available upon technical consultation for specialized filtration projects.
